About the COMET 770
Originally designed as an IOR 1/4 ton racer.
The Comet 770 is a compact, performance-oriented cruiser designed by Groupe Finot and built by Comar (ITA) between 1973 and 1978. With a displacement of 3550.0 lb and a D/L ratio of 250.3, this 25.25 ft vessel represents a lightweight, fin-keel design from the early 1970s.
- Best for:
- This boat suits coastal cruisers and weekend racers who prioritize speed and agility over heavy offshore comfort, given its low displacement and high SA/D ratio of 23.09.
- Bluewater capability:
- With a capsize ratio of 2.28 and a comfort ratio of 15.05, the Comet 770 is best suited for protected coastal waters rather than extended bluewater passages due to its light displacement and narrow beam.
- Comparables:
- Comparable boats include the O'Day 23 and Pearson 23, which share similar dimensions and eras, though the Comet 770 distinguishes itself with a lighter displacement and higher sail area for better upwind performance.
